I ended my fwb will he be back?

First and foremost, congratulations on taking the brave step to end your friends-with-benefits situation.

I know that this can be a difficult decision, and I commend you for prioritizing your own emotional wellbeing.

As for whether or not your former FWB will come back, it’s important to remember that every situation is unique.

However, in my experience, I can tell you that there are a few common factors that can influence whether or not someone will try to rekindle a casual sexual relationship after it has ended.

One of the most important factors is the level of emotional attachment that each person has to the other.

If one person is more emotionally invested than the other, it can create an uneven power dynamic that can ultimately lead to hurt feelings or resentment.

Additionally, if there were any lingering issues or conflicts that were not resolved before the end of the FWB relationship, those can also be a factor in whether or not your former partner will try to come back.

The first thing to consider is why you ended the relationship in the first place. Was it because you no longer felt fulfilled by the arrangement, or were there other factors at play?

It’s important to be clear on your reasons, as this will give you a better idea of whether or not your FWB will be back.

If your decision to end the relationship was final and you don’t see yourself getting back together with your FWB, then it’s best to communicate that to them clearly.

Being honest and upfront about your feelings will save both of you from any unnecessary hurt or confusion.

On the other hand, if you’re open to the possibility of rekindling things with your FWB, then it’s important to give them space and time to process their own emotions.

Don’t rush into anything, and let them come to their own conclusions about what they want from the relationship.

Ultimately, only time will tell whether or not your FWB will come back. But by being honest with yourself and your partner, you can ensure that you’re making the right decision for both of you.

I want my fwb back, what to do?

If you’ve decided that you want your FWB back, there are a few things you can do to increase the chances of a successful reconciliation:

1. Be honest with yourself: Take some time to reflect on why you want to get back together with your FWB.

Make sure that you’re not just feeling lonely or looking for a quick fix. Be honest about your feelings and what you hope to get out of the relationship.

2. Reach out to your FWB: If you feel ready to talk to your FWB, reach out to them and express your feelings. Be clear about what you want and why you want it.

It’s important to be honest and upfront about your intentions, so there are no misunderstandings or hurt feelings.

3. Give them space: If your FWB needs some time to think about things or isn’t ready to reconcile yet, respect their wishes and give them space.

Don’t pressure them or try to manipulate them into getting back together with you. Let them make their own decisions.

4. Address the issues that led to the breakup: If there were specific issues or problems that led to the breakup, address them openly and honestly.

Discuss ways to prevent those issues from happening again in the future.

5. Take it slow: If you do decide to get back together with your FWB, take things slow and don’t rush into anything.

Rebuilding trust and emotional intimacy takes time, so be patient and understanding.

6. Be willing to compromise: Both you and your FWB may need to make compromises in order to make the relationship work.

Be willing to listen to their needs and make adjustments where necessary.

Remember, getting back together with an ex-FWB is not always easy, and there are no guarantees that it will work out.

However, by being honest, respectful, and understanding, you can increase the chances of a successful reconciliation. Good luck!
